GithubHelp home page GithubHelp logo

czifumasa / ytmusic-lib-tracker Goto Github PK

View Code? Open in Web Editor NEW
11.0 4.0 2.0 6.49 MB

Useful tools for youtube music. Exporting library to csv, tracking changes in library, summary of transfer from GPM

License: MIT License

Python 100.00%
youtube youtubemusic googleplaymusic transfer music ytm gpm tracker changelog export

ytmusic-lib-tracker's People

Contributors

czifumasa avatar dependabot[bot] avatar ohshazbot av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ar

Forkers

hharzer ohshazbot

ytmusic-lib-tracker's Issues

Failed with error

Completes login successfully.
Completes fetching tracks from library and uploaded music.
Then two errors:
Error 1
"Fetching tracks from 'Liked Music' playlist...
Invalid Response: 1131/1139, retrying...
Fetched 1131 tracks from 'Liked Music' playlist"
Error 2
"Fetching tracks from 'Music' playlist...
Invalid Response: 10/15, retrying...
Fetched 10 tracks from 'Music' playlist"
Fetches all other playlists successfully
Closes with
"KeyError: 'contents'

Press Enter to exit..."
No csv files are generated.

Nonetype is not subscriptable

Hey, trying to use this for the first time and getting:

Fetching tracks from library, it may take a while...
TypeError: 'NoneType' object is not subscriptable

after login. I pulled my credentials from Firefox 109.0.1. If there's a way to enable stack traces LMK and I can provide that as well.

error: "key error: contents"

at the end of a successful run of the script I get the error and the CSV is unfortunately not saved, though the script indicated that it was able to pull all of the songs from the library.

Any ideas?

PS Thanks for this great program, it's just what I need!

Support export results from gmusic-playlist.js

For now only export results created by YTM_PlaylistTracker are supported. It would be nice to directly support input files created by gmusic-playlist.js without need to readjust them in excel.

Handle playlist renaming

When user renames playlist it should be possible to detect the change if playlist stil has the same id

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.